  • Description Benzophenone-3,3',4, 4'-tetracarboxylic dianhydride (BTDA) is used as intermediate and in polycondensation (fiber and powder production) to manufacture plastic products or fine chemicals in the industrial sector. Consumer risk is very unlikely as BTDA is manufactured and handled under closed conditions in industrial settings only. The environmental effects, ecotoxicology and toxicology information available for BTDA is provided based on studies and/or a reliable evaluation of its hazardous properties.
  • Uses BTDA is used as intermediate in the manufacture of plastic products or fine chemicals in the industrial sector. BTDA is important monomer of polyimide, and used for production of polyimide material. Used in the synthesis of polyimides. BTDA polymer fine free-flowing powder suitable for general purposes. BTDA Microfine Micronized powder facilitates mixing in epoxy resins. BTDA ultrapure high-purity, high-assay powder for critical polyimide synthesis.
  • Physical properties BTDA is a tan-colored crystalline powder. The substance has a melting point of 218.67 °C and shows decomposition at 360 °C. The auto-ignition temperature is very high and no flammability is observed. The substance has a density of 1.5452 g/ml and a vapor pressure of 6.53E-011 Pa. The substance is slightly water soluble and has a log Pow of 3.3.
